## ThumbForge Environments

Hey on-call folks — ThumbForge (the thumbnail generation queue) runs in sandbox, staging, and prod. Sandbox is fair game for testing; staging mirrors prod traffic at 10%, so don't panic if queues look busy there. Prod workers autoscale, but if latency spikes, check the queue depth first. For quick reference, prod currently runs with the following configuration values.

deployment values, yadug-bawif:
[framir]
team = pelox
access_code = ac_a38ab2
owner = tamion.julael
host = framir.tolvaqlabs.test
port = 11211
peer = tammir.zemvargrid.local
salt = 2215ef03
pin = 1541

Hi Renna — handing off the Quillbase admin table cleanup. I ran the bulk edit on stale merchant rows Tuesday; about 400 remain flagged for review. The script logs to the opsdash channel, and rollback snapshots are kept for seven days. Nothing urgent pending. If anything looks off, reach the data tooling desk here.

alerts address for bajop-yahog: istwyn@lumiclabs.internal

Large event tables in Quillbase are partitioned by calendar month. Support notes: queries spanning more than the allowed partition range are rejected, not slowed. Retention jobs drop partitions past the cutoff nightly; restores from dropped partitions require an ops ticket. Per-partition row counts above the soft limit trigger alerts; above the hard limit, writes to that partition are throttled. Check the partition dashboard before escalating slow-query complaints. Current limits are defined by these constants.

constants for kageg-bawif:
QUOTAS = {
    "quenwyn": 1,
    "oliix": 10,
}

## Sketchloom 5.2 — Changed defaults

Undo/redo history is now persisted encrypted at rest; previously plaintext in local storage. History depth capped at 200 entries by default (was unlimited). Redo stacks cleared on session end. Cross-document undo disabled. Reviewers should confirm no stale plaintext histories survive upgrade. The new default configuration shipping with 5.2 follows below.

settings of bawif-fawif:
ralix:
  log_level: warn
  metrics_host: metrics.ralix.tolvaqsys.internal
  pool_size: 32